    Login Problems (GUI)?

    Hey, I installed KNOPPIX to the hd, but now I can't login to the gui. I reboot, get a GUI with a dabien background asking me for a username and password, and give it, but when I hit go my monitor just flickers a few times and sends me back to the login screen. I tried rebooting under a command line, and logged in as root and then typed in startX, and it just flickered a few times and went back to the command line. Do you know how I can get into the account's GUI?

    btw, when I try to start it by typing startkde in the command line it just says X server error indefinately

    I'm already using the 2/9/2004 version installed on my hd. I had the same problem as well, and somehow remembered to switch to the kde3 login and it let me through. Upon subsequent reboots, i noted in dmesg that the xdm wouldn't load because it wasn't the default. Fixed that by editing the xdm script file in /etc/init.d. Look for a line that says "HEED_DEFAULT_DISPLAY_MANAGER=true" and change it to false. Reboot and it should work ok.

    I had a similar problem it turned out to be a wrong choice on video display cheat codes. At login the Debian screen would vanish then come back like I had not tried to login. If you can get a gui using something other than the default kdm I would say its graphics/cheat code related. Try one of the other lite gui's out there. The login screen has a drop down box of gui choices.
